Specific Architecture Tools
- to generate the Project Start Architecture (PSA) and – after finishing parts of the project – the Project End Architecture (PEA)
- to assist projects during the design phase
Architecture tools support Project or Solution Architects before, during and after the project.
The pre-project and after-project phases by present state analysis (DTA), adjusting components and developing new components (AAM), generating Project Start Architecture documents (PSA) and Project End Architecture documents (PEA):
